SEDALIA, Mo. --- A Sedalia hunter bagged a big buck on the second day of firearms season, but the kill caused him a lot of pain.

Forty-nine-year-old Randy Goodman said he thought two well-placed shots with his .270-caliber rifle had killed the buck on Nov. 19. Goodman said the deer looked dead to him, but seconds later the nine-point, 240-pound animal came to life.

The buck rose up, knocked Goodman down and attacked him with his antlers in what the veteran hunter called "15 seconds of hell." The deer ran a short distance and went down, and died after Goodman fired two more shots.

Soon Goodman started feeling dizzy and noticed his vest was soaked in blood.

So he reached his truck and drove to a hospital, where he received seven staples in his scalp and was treated for a slight concussion and bruises.

I AM a deer hunter and missed a buck on Turkey day morning. Fucker came to within 10 yards of me at appx. 9AM while I was picking my shit up and preparing to move. My rifle was leaning against the tree. I managed to pick up the rifle and cock the hammer back (TC Encore .280) without him noticing. Then as he dropped his head behind a tree, I snapped the rifle up and he heard me. I sighted his ass in at about 20 yards as he ran off in the hopes to fire a shot into his ass and knock him down, and second shot in for the kill. Needless to say, I missed by about 6 inches left and blew a small oak apart.

FUCK!!!!!! I was so ashamed that I didn't go to Turkey day dinner, instead I hunted...looking for retribution but he didn't show up again that night.

If I had just moved more slowly, more fluid. He would have been a very dead buck and in my freezer by now...but alas, hindsight is always 20/20. I'll try to be more calm next time...I just couldn't get over how close he got to me and how easily I was thinking that I got my deer. They are dumber than shit, but so incredibly in touch with their surroundings...any noise, any scent that is slightly off and they're outta there, and fucking FAST.

God, I love deer hunting. But then again, this is why it's called hunting and not just shooting. Anyone can pull a trigger, but a real hunter can bring home the meat. I made a n00b mistake, and now I'm paying for it with an empty freezer.

2 weeks left in Maine...all muzzleloader.
